Afrobeats star Asake has revealed the inspiration behind his recent appearance change, which has sparked much discussion among fans. The singer, known for his dreadlocks, debuted a new look with face tattoos and a much shorter hairstyle. During a red-carpet interview at the 2025 Grammy Awards, Asake shared that the transformation was a personal decision driven by his desire for comfort and self-expression.
He explained that his appearance is a reflection of his current mood and that he loves to feel at ease with how he presents himself. "This is how I feel now," he said, emphasizing that his look might change again in the future. Asake noted that this transformation is not influenced by anyone but his preferences.
In the same interview, Asake expressed gratitude for his Grammy nomination in the ‘Best African Music Performance’ category for his collaboration with Wizkid on “MMS.” Though he did not win the award, losing to fellow Nigerian artist Tems, Asake expressed being “blessed and honored” to be nominated among the best.
